Description

The first three books of the charming Critter Club chapter book series about best friends who care for lost and lonely animals are now available together in one paperback bind-up!

Amy, Ellie, Liz, and Marion each have their own different personalities and interests, but they all have one thing in common: a serious love of animals. The Critter Club gets its start when Amy is the only one staying home in Santa Vista for spring break. While helping at her mom's vet clinic, she encounters cold and elusive millionaire Marge Sullivan's puppy Rufus...and an unexpected mystery. After her friends return home, the girls get to the bottom of what happened to Rufus--and discover a way to help other lost and lonely animals in their town.

Their mission continues with a group of baby rabbits, but Ellie is distracted from her club responsibilities when she lands the lead role in their elementary school's Spring Spectacular. Then, Liz's plans of a vacation spent making art and spending time with her friends at The Critter Club change when she's stuck in summer school.

With easy-to-read language and illustrations on almost every page, The Critter Club chapter books are perfect for beginning readers.

This heartwarming paperback bind-up includes:
Amy and the Missing Puppy
All About Ellie
Liz Learns a Lesson

Callie Barkley
Callie Barkley loves animals. As a young girl, she dreamed of getting a cat or dog of her own until she discovered she was allergic to most of them. It was around this time that she realized the world was full of all kinds of critters that could use some love. She now lives with her husband and two kids in Connecticut. They share their home with exactly ten fish and a very active ant farm.

Tracy Bishop has loved drawing since she was a little girl in Japan. She spends her time illustrating books, reading, and collecting pens. She lives with her husband, son, and hairy dog, named Harry, in San Jose, California.
